BLUE CHEESE POTATO SALAD



Blue Cheese Potato Salad image

This is a delicious zesty potato salad.

Provided by TOSWEETFORU

Categories     Salad     Potato Salad Recipes     No Mayo

Time 45m

Yield 5

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 slices bacon
2 pounds red new potatoes
½ cup olive oil
3 tablespoons white vinegar
1 bunch green onions, chopped
½ te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 ½ ounces blue cheese, crumbled

Steps:

  • Place bacon in a large, deep skillet. Cook over medium high heat until evenly brown. Drain, crumble and set aside.
  •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add potatoes and cook until tender but still firm, about 15 minutes. Drain, cool and chop. leaving skins on.
  • In a large bowl, whisk together the oil, vinegar, green onions, salt and pepper. Add the potatoes, bacon and cheese and toss to coat.

SOUTHERN LIVING'S BLUE CHEESE AND GREEN ONION POTATO SALAD, MODIFIED



Southern Living's Blue Cheese and Green Onion Potato Salad, modified image

This potato salad is a reduced-calorie version of a Southern Living recipe. It is delicious served warm or room termperature. The blue cheese flavor is stronger when it is served cold.

Categories     Appetizers / Soups / Salads     Side Dish     Appetizers / Soups / Salads Side Dish

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 pounds new potatoes, quartered
2 teaspoons salt, divided
1/3 cup sliced green onions
1 (8-oz.) container sour cream
1/2 cup refrigerated blue cheese dressing
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ground pepper
1/2 cup crumbled blue cheese

Steps:

  • Bring potatoes, 1 tsp. salt, and water to cover to a boil. Cook 10 to 15 minutes or just until tender; drain.
  • Stir together green onions, next 3 ingredients, and remaining salt in a large bowl; add potatoes and crumbled blue cheese, stirring gently to coat. Serve immediately, or cover and chill until ready to serve.
  • Serves 8 1-cup servings

BLUE CHEESE POTATO SALAD



Blue Cheese Potato Salad image

Try my tasty blue cheese spin on classic potato salad. You can easily double the recipe for large picnics or potlucks. -Jennifer Lewis, Britton,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 50m

Yield 10 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 14

2-1/2 pounds red potatoes (about 7 medium), cut into 3/4-inch pieces
2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
1-1/2 teaspoons hot pepper sauce
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on coarsely ground pepper
2 hard-boiled large eggs, finely chopped
1/4 cup finely chopped red onion
1/4 cup finely chopped celery
1/4 cup chopped sweet pickles
2 green onions, finely chopped
1/4 cup sour cream
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1/4 cup blue cheese salad dressing
1/2 teaspoon celery seed

Steps:

  • Place potatoes in a 6-qt. stockpot; add water to cover.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cook, uncovered, 7-10 minutes or just until tender. Drain; transfer to a large bowl., Add vinegar, pepper sauce, salt and pepper to hot potatoes; let stand 30 minutes at room temperature, stirring gently halfway through standing. Add eggs, onion, celery, pickles and green onions. In a small bowl, mix remaining ingredients; add to potato mixture. Toss gently to coat. Serve immediately or refrigerate until cold.

NEW YORK STRIP WITH BLUE CHEESE, VIDALIA ONION JAM AND WARM POTATO SALAD WITH MUSTARD VINAIGRETTE



New York Strip with Blue Cheese, Vidalia Onion Jam and Warm Potato Salad with Mustard Vinaigrette image

Provided by Bobby Flay

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h35m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 29

2 tablespoons bacon drippings
3 Vidalia onions, peeled, halved, sliced 1/4-inch thick
2 cloves garlic, finely chopped
1 jalapeno chile, finely diced
1/2 cup red wine
1/4 cup red wine vinegar
2 tablespoons creme de cassis
2 tablespoons grenadine
Honey, to taste
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/4 cup ch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
2 1/2 pounds red new potatoes
1/2 pound slab bacon, cut into lardons and cooked until golden brown and crisp, 2 tablespoons drippings reserved
1/4 cup red wine vinegar
2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on honey
2 cloves chopped garlic
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/4 to 1/3 cup olive oil
2 tablespoons roughly chopped basil leaves
2 tablespoons roughly chopped flat-leaf parsley
2 tablespoons kosher salt
1 tablespoon coarsely ground black pepper
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h thyme leaves
Canola oil
4 NY Strip steaks (12-ounces each) removed from the refrigerator 20 minutes before grilling
3/4 pound wedge blue cheese (recommended: Cabrales), room temperature
2 to 3 tablespoons heavy cream
Handful parsley sprigs

Steps:

  • For the onion jam: Heat grill to high. Heat a cast iron skillet until hot, but not smoking. Add the drippings, heat, and then the onions, garlic, jalapeno, wine, vinegar, cassis, grenadine and salt and pepper and cook, stirring occasionally, until the liquid mixture is thickened and jam-like, about 20 minutes. Taste and season with honey, salt and pepper. Stir in the parsley, transfer to a bowl and let cool to room temperature.
  • For the vinaigrette: Put the potatoes in a large saucepan, cover with cold water and season with 1 tablespoon kosher salt. Bring to a boil and cook until tender when pierced with a knife. Drain, let cool for a few minutes and quarter
  • While the potatoes are cooking, whisk together the drippings, vinegar, mustard, honey, garlic, salt and pepper. Slowly whisk in the olive oil, and then stir in the chopped basil and parsley.
  • Add the warm potatoes and the bacon to the vinaigrette and gently fold to combine. Serve with the steak.
  • For the steak: Heat the grill to high. Mix together the salt, pepper and thyme in a small bowl. Brush the steaks with oil on both sides and season with the salt mixture. Grill steaks until golden brown and slightly charred on both sides and cooked to medium-rare doneness.
  • Just before the steaks are done, use a fork to mash the cheese with some of the cream, so that it is chunky but a bit creamy. Mound some on each steak, and let melt very briefly, so the steaks don't overcook. Remove to a platter and let rest 5 minutes before serving. Top with parsley sprigs and serve.

GRILLED POTATO SALAD WITH WATERCRESS, GREEN ONIONS, AND BLUE CHEESE VINAIGRETTE



Grilled Potato Salad with Watercress, Green Onions, and Blue Cheese Vinaigrette image

Provided by Bobby Flay

Categories     Salad     Potato     Side     Summer     Grill/Barbecue     Bon Appétit     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Makes 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/4 cup Sherry wine vinegar
1 large shallot, chopped
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
1/2 cup olive oil
1/2 cup crumbled blue cheese
12 medium red-skinned potatoes, unpeeled (about 2 3/4 pounds)
Additional olive oil
2 bunches watercress, stems trimmed
3 green onions, chopped

Steps:

  • Combine vinegar, shallot, and mustard in medium bowl. Gradually whisk in oil. Mix in cheese. Season vinaigrette to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Cook potatoes in large pot of boiling salted water until almost tender, about 16 minutes. Drain; cool completely. Cut potatoes into 1/4- to 1/2-inch-thick rounds. Brush rounds on both sides with oil; s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  • Prepare barbecue (medium-high heat). Arrange watercress on platter. Grill potatoes until golden and cooked through, about 3 minutes per side.
  • Mound warm potatoes atop watercress; sprinkle with green onions. Spoon vinaigrette over potatoes.

BLUE CHEESE POTATO SALAD



Blue Cheese Potato Salad image

Categories     Salad     Cheese     Mustard     Potato     Mayonnaise     Blue Cheese     Summer     Chill     Sour Cream     Bon Appétit

Yield Serves 12

Number Of Ingredients 10

5 pounds red new potatoes
1/2 cup dry white wine
Salt and freshly ground pepper
1 1/4 cups mayonnaise
1 1/4 cups sour cream
2 1/2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
2 1/2 tablespoons cider vinegar
1/2 pound blue cheese, crumbled
5 green onions, minced
1 1/2 cups chopped celery

Steps:

  • Place potatoes in large pot. Cover with cold water. Boil until tender. Drain. Cool slightly. Peel potatoes. Cut into 1-inch pieces. Transfer to large bowl. Add wine, season with salt and pepper and toss to coat. Cool.
  • Combine all remaining ingredients. Mix with potatoes. Adjust seasoning. (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ate. Let stand 30 minutes at room temperature before serving.)
